When I go to make a new C# Windows application in VS 2010, there is an option at the bottom right area with a check bo开发者_运维问答x saying add to source.
I want to know what happens, if I check it and create the new C# file.
I believe it actually says, "Add to Source Control." That will register the project with whichever source control plugin you have enabled in VS.
If you have a source control plugin configured to work with Visual Studio, checking that box will create the new application in the source control in a manner defined by the plugin that you're using.
